SDF Repel Attack by Pro-Government Forces on Kobani Outskirts

SDF on high alert to repel attacks by government forces.
The Syrian Democratic Forces (SDF) have successfully thwarted an assault by pro-Syrian government armed factions on the outskirts of Jalabiya, a town in Kobani, western Kurdistan (North and East Syria), following intense clashes between the two sides.
The Syrian Observatory for Human Rights (SOHR) said in a statement that the clashes erupted after the factions attempted to advance on SDF positions surrounding the town, adding that the SDF repelled the attack, capturing five militants and injuring others.
The Observatory confirmed that medium and heavy weaponry was used during the clashes, which also prompted the displacement of civilians from the Kobani countryside to the city and that a state of high alert has been declared in the area, though no information regarding civilian casualties has been reported so far.
The SOHR noted that the assault forms part of the ongoing military escalation in the Kobani countryside, warning of the potential repercussions for both the humanitarian and security situation in the region. It reported that heavy fighting took place between the SDF and factions loyal to the Syrian Interim Government near Jalabiya, located between the Tall Abyad and Kobani countryside.
The Observatory added that the attacks were not confined to Jalabiya but also targeted several other Kurdish villages, including Khanamed, Karbnab, Maraser, and Kharab Raz, which caused widespread fear among residents, forcing some to flee their homes.
Meanwhile, the SDF said in a press release: “The SDF and the Women’s Protection Units (YPJ) repelled five attacks launched by Damascus-backed factions on the countryside of Sarrin, south of Kobani, following direct clashes that continue in the area.”
Tensions have been rising in northern and eastern Syria as government forces have launched attacks on areas controlled by the Kurdish-led Syrian Democratic Forces (SDF). These attacks have targeted sites housing prisons and camps for Islamic State (ISIS) detainees and their families, following the collapse of negotiations between the two sides.
